Brighthouse Financial Inc.’s depositary shares (BHFAN)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$4.35, falling short of the consensus estimate of $4.7036 by 7.52%. Revenue figures were not disclosed. Despite the earnings miss, the stock rose 1.21% in the following session, reflecting investor focus on the company’s solid dividend yield and strategic positioning.

Management commentary centered on the challenging operating environment for the life insurance and annuity sector. The company noted that higher claims experience and elevated expenses in the variable annuity segment pressured earnings. Net investment income benefited from a favorable fixed-income yield curve, but this was partially offset by lower fee income from variable products as equity market volatility persisted. Margins in the core retirement and income solutions business tightened due to increased policyholder benefit costs. Management emphasized that the quarter’s results were within their internal planning range, despite the reported EPS miss. The company continues to execute on its capital management strategy, including the repurchase of preferred shares at accretive levels, which contributed to the reported EPS figure. However, the absence of revenue disclosure limits full transparency into top-line trends. The firm also highlighted progress in reducing operating expenses through its ongoing efficiency initiatives, which may provide margin support in the coming quarters.

For the remainder of fiscal 2026, Brighthouse Financial offered a cautious outlook. The company expects continued headwinds from the interest rate environment, though lower volatility in equity markets could improve fee income. Management anticipates that policyholder behavior will normalize, potentially reducing the elevated claims seen in Q1. Strategic priorities include maintaining strong risk-based capital ratios, optimizing the product mix toward less capital-intensive solutions, and managing the in-force block efficiently. No specific EPS or revenue guidance was provided, but the company indicated that full-year earnings may be influenced by market movements and the pace of expense reductions. The company also reiterated its commitment to the preferred dividend schedule, noting that the 5.375% non-cumulative Series C dividend remains well covered by current earnings. Risk factors include adverse changes in mortality or morbidity assumptions, prolonged market volatility, and regulatory developments affecting annuity product design.

The stock’s 1.21% gain following the earnings release suggests that the EPS miss was largely anticipated or that investors focused on the sustainable dividend yield offered by the Series C preferred shares. Analysts in the insurance sector noted that the 7.52% EPS surprise miss was relatively moderate and that the company’s capital position remains strong. Some analysts may adjust their near-term earnings estimates downward, but the preferred share class is less sensitive to bottom-line fluctuations than common equity. What to watch next includes the company’s second-quarter earnings report, any updates on the expense-saving initiatives, and the trajectory of annuity sales. The ongoing low interest rate environment and competitive pressures in the retail annuity market could continue to weigh on profitability. Overall, the market response indicates a balanced view – acknowledging the earnings shortfall while recognizing the stability of the preferred dividend.
